Here are the best practices to run a focus group successfully: Determine the Topic of Discussion and its Objectives . Before selecting and approaching participants to join the focus group, determine the discussion topics clearly. It is advisable to narrow your focus group discussion to one or a few topics, so the discussion doesn't deviate.18-May-2020 ... May 23, 2023 · Here are some ways to run remote focus groups in order to reap the same benefits and results. 1. Synchronous multi-person video conferences. The most common method for running remote focus groups is with synchronous multi-person video conferences. In focus groups, qualitative data takes center stage. Survey data is unbelievably powerful, but it's hard to understand the rationale for the numbers without context. Focus groups are a way to understand how someone truly feels about your business and provide the why behind the ...
